400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么重新排序会重复

作者:路由通
|
304人看过
发布时间:2025-12-28 21:43:05
标签:
当用户对表格数据重新排序时出现重复条目,通常源于数据透视表缓存未更新、排序范围选择不全或隐藏行列干扰等底层机制。本文通过十二个技术维度系统解析重复现象的成因,涵盖数据类型混淆、公式动态引用、合并单元格陷阱等常见场景,并结合官方文档说明解决方案。文章将指导读者通过分列工具规范数据格式、使用删除重复项功能等实操方法,从根本上规避排序异常问题。
excel为什么重新排序会重复

       数据透视表缓存滞后引发的排序异常

       数据透视表在执行排序操作时依赖的是初始的数据快照而非实时数据。当源数据区域发生增减或修改后,若未通过刷新功能更新缓存,重新排序就会基于过时数据生成重复显示。这种现象在链接外部数据源的场景中尤为明显,用户往往误认为排序功能失效,实则是数据同步机制未触发。

       隐藏行列对排序范围的隐性干扰

       当用户隐藏部分行或列后进行区域排序,软件可能仅对可见单元格进行操作。这种默认设置会导致被隐藏数据在排序后与可见数据产生位置错位,重新显示时形成视觉重复。通过快捷键组合显示所有隐藏内容后,往往会发现数据实际仍保持原有序列,只是显示逻辑出现混乱。

       数据类型混杂导致的排序逻辑错乱

       若同一列混合存放文本型数字与数值型数字,排序算法会分别归类处理。例如"001"和1被识别为不同数据类型,升序排列时可能分别出现在首尾两端。这种因数据存储格式不统一造成的重复假象,需要通过分列功能统一单元格格式才能彻底解决。

       合并单元格对排序算法的破坏性影响

       合并单元格在排序时会被视为单个数据单元,但其实际占据多个物理位置。当排序依据列存在合并单元格时,相邻数据的对应关系会发生错乱,导致部分内容被重复映射到不同排序位置。官方建议始终避免在需要排序的数据区域使用合并单元格功能。

       多级排序规则设置不当引发的叠加重复

       当设置主要关键字和次要关键字排序时,若两级关键字存在包含关系,会导致部分数据在多个排序层级重复出现。例如先按省份排序再按城市排序,但城市数据已包含省份信息,这种规则重叠会使某些条目同时满足多个排序条件而重复显示。

       公式动态引用产生的数据镜像效应

       使用间接引用或偏移函数等动态公式时,排序操作会改变公式的参照基准。当公式引用的单元格位置发生位移后,可能在不同位置生成相同计算结果。这种由公式循环引用造成的重复现象,需要将公式转换为数值后再进行排序操作。

       自定义排序列表与实际数据不匹配

       当用户自定义了包含重复元素的排序序列(如将"高优先级"同时设置在序列首尾),应用该自定义排序时会导致符合条件的数据在排序结果中重复出现。这种人为设置的规则冲突往往容易被忽视,需要检查选项中的自定义列表配置。

       筛选状态下的部分排序陷阱

       在启用自动筛选的情况下执行排序,系统默认仅对可见筛选结果进行操作。但当选区包含隐藏行时,不同筛选条件切换后会显现出不同的排序结果,造成数据重复显示的错觉。完整排序需要先取消所有筛选条件。

       跨工作表引用更新的延迟现象

       当排序数据区域包含指向其他工作表的链接公式时,若源工作表数据更新后未及时刷新,排序操作会基于缓存值进行排列。待刷新后,实际数据与排序位置不匹配,形成重复条目假象。这类问题需要通过编辑链接功能手动更新数据源。

       条件格式规则与排序的显示冲突

       某些条件格式规则(如基于排名的色阶设置)会在排序后重新计算应用范围。当规则应用范围与排序区域存在偏差时,相同数据可能被多次标记格式,在视觉上产生重复感。需要将条件格式的应用范围调整为绝对引用以固定格式区域。

       宏代码执行不完全造成的残留数据

       运行包含排序操作的宏时,若代码未完整执行或中断后重试,可能导致部分数据既保留在原位又被复制到新位置。这种由程序执行异常造成的重复需要通过逐步调试宏代码来定位问题语句。

       外部数据查询刷新机制缺陷

       通过数据查询功能导入的外部数据在设置自动刷新时,若刷新周期与排序操作时间重叠,可能生成数据版本冲突。新导入的数据会与已排序数据并存,形成重复记录。合理设置刷新间隔或改为手动刷新可避免此问题。

       数组公式溢出区域的排序异常

       动态数组公式的溢出区域在进行排序时,可能因计算顺序问题导致部分结果重复显示。当排序操作触发数组重算时,旧值未及时清除而新值已生成,造成短暂的数据重复。将数组公式转换为普通公式可消除此现象。

       共享工作簿的版本冲突再现

       在多用户协同编辑的共享工作簿中,当两个用户同时对相同数据区域进行排序操作时,系统会保留冲突版本形成重复数据条目。这种协同场景下的排序问题需要通过比较合并工作簿功能进行数据整合。

       排序保护与权限限制的叠加效应

       当工作表设置部分区域保护时,排序操作可能因权限不足而无法完整执行。受保护单元格保持原位,而未保护单元格正常排序,这种错位会导致数据重复显示。需要临时解除保护或调整保护范围后再排序。

       内存优化机制引发的数据暂存

       处理大型数据集时,软件的内存优化功能可能将部分数据暂存至虚拟内存。排序过程中若暂存数据未能及时同步回主内存,会造成数据副本共存的现象。清理剪贴板并重启应用可释放被占用的内存资源。

       分级显示组合对排序的干扰

       使用分组功能创建的分级显示在折叠状态下进行排序,会打乱原有数据层级关系。展开分组后,部分数据可能同时出现在多个组别形成重复。排序前应先取消所有分组确保数据完整性。

       通过系统分析这些典型场景可知,排序重复现象多源于数据状态与操作环境的匹配问题。建议用户在执行排序前先规范数据格式、统一数据源状态,并善用删除重复项工具进行预处理,方可确保排序结果的准确性和唯一性。

相关文章
word标尺滑块为什么不随空格
本文将深入分析Word标尺滑块不随空格移动的十二个关键因素,涵盖制表符类型设置、段落格式继承、视图模式限制等核心技术原理,并提供详细的故障排查方案和实用操作指南,帮助用户彻底解决这一常见排版问题。
2025-12-28 21:42:30
214人看过
电视如何用遥控器
本文将全面解析电视遥控器的使用技巧,从基础按键功能到高级操作设置,涵盖红外与蓝牙连接区别、语音助手调用方法、多设备切换方案等12个核心知识点,帮助用户彻底掌握遥控器的智能化应用场景。
2025-12-28 21:41:51
362人看过
减速机的作用是什么
减速机作为工业传动系统的核心部件,主要通过降低转速、增大扭矩来匹配动力源与工作机的载荷需求。其作用涵盖动力传输调节、运动精度控制、设备保护及能效优化等关键领域,广泛应用于制造业、交通运输、重型机械等行业场景。
2025-12-28 21:41:12
248人看过
分辨率最高是多少
本文系统探讨分辨率的理论极限与当前技术边界。从人眼生理极限出发,分析显示技术发展现状,涵盖消费级设备与专业领域应用。通过对比不同技术路径的物理限制,揭示16K、32K等超高清标准的实现瓶颈,并展望未来显示技术的突破方向。
2025-12-28 21:40:39
101人看过
Excel表格打印为什么不能用
本文详细解析Excel表格打印失败的十二个常见原因及解决方案,涵盖页面设置错误、打印区域未定义、驱动程序异常等核心技术问题,并提供权威的官方故障排除方法,帮助用户彻底解决打印难题。
2025-12-28 21:33:08
74人看过
word文字为什么不能向左移
在微软文字处理软件使用过程中,用户常会遇到文字无法向左移动的情况。这一现象背后涉及页面布局、段落格式、制表位设置等多重技术因素。本文通过十二个关键维度系统解析该问题的成因,涵盖页边距调整、缩进机制、表格单元格属性等常见场景,并提供具体操作解决方案。深入理解文字定位逻辑将有效提升文档排版效率,避免格式错乱问题。
2025-12-28 21:32:37
372人看过